How much do care man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for care manager in Riverside, NJ is $56,920.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$42,400.00 and $64,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Care Manager vs Social Worker?

AspectCare ManagerSocial Worker
CredentialsCertifications like CCM or CMC, relevant healthcare trainingLicensure as LCSW, LSW, or LMSW, social work degree
Work EnvironmentHealthcare settings, patient homes, clinicsHospitals, community agencies, schools
Employer & IndustryHospitals, insurance companies, senior care facilitiesHospitals, social service agencies, mental health clinics

Care Managers and Social Workers both support patient well-being but differ in focus. Care Managers primarily coordinate healthcare services and manage care plans, while Social Workers address broader social and emotional needs, often providing counseling and resource connection. Understanding these differences helps in choosing the right professional for specific support needs.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a care man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Care Manager, you need a background in healthcare or social work, strong case management skills, and often a relevant certification such as CCM (Certified Case Manager). Familiarity with electronic health record (EHR) systems, care planning software, and risk assessment tools is typically required. Exceptional communication, problem-solving, and organizational skills help Care Managers build trust with clients and coordinate multidisciplinary teams. These skills are crucial for ensuring clients receive comprehensive, effective care tailored to their needs.

What are some common challenges faced by care managers when coordinating care among multidisciplinary teams?

Care Managers often encounter challenges such as ensuring consistent communication among healthcare providers, managing differing treatment recommendations, and aligning care plans with patients’ preferences and insurance requirements. Navigating these complexities requires strong organizational skills and the ability to advocate for patients while balancing input from physicians, nurses, social workers, and family members. Developing effective collaboration strategies and staying current with care coordination best practices can help Care Managers overcome these obstacles and deliver high-quality patient outcomes.

What is a care manager?

A Care Manager is a professional who coordinates and manages care plans for individuals, often those with complex health or social needs. They work closely with patients, families, healthcare providers, and community resources to ensure that all aspects of a person's care are organized and effective. Care Managers assess needs, develop care plans, monitor progress, and advocate for clients to help them achieve the best possible outcomes. This role is common in healthcare settings, long-term care facilities, and social service agencies.

Job description

Join our team today and immerse yourself in a rewarding career for years to come!
As a Care Manager you will be working with adults with mental illness and/or substance use disorders, children with serious emotional disturbance, members of the armed services and veterans. Our programs service adults, children, and families. Your role will be essential to our success, and your efforts will influence our ability to provide treatment to our community.
Competencies:
Ability to provide Person Centered, Family-Centered, and Trauma-Informed Care; Understanding and commitment to supporting recovery and resiliency; Ability to assess and interpret information related to population; Knowledge of the symptoms of the disability/disorder and ability to recognize exacerbation of symptoms; General understanding of treatment needs; Knowledge of available treatment resources and appropriate use; Population-specific communication skills; Understanding of Care Coordination; General knowledge of housing subsidies and management of the subsidies.
Responsibilities:
  • Provides community-based services to consumers and consumer's family in the community;
  • Facilitates service linkage in the mental health and non-mental health, health system; coordinating and integrating services from multiple providers;
  • Assists and supports individuals in developing skills to gain access to needed medical, behavioral health, housing, employment, social, educational and other services essential to meeting basic needs;
  • Provides training and/or direct service support to individuals in the use of basic community resources such as transportation and financial resources;
  • Provides necessary support to ensure that individuals needs and goals are addressed, including aggressive advocacy, escort to appointment, daily living skill remediation and money management;
  • Provides accurate and timely documentation of services in the electronic health record;
  • Provides 24 hours/7 days per week on call crises intervention, including in person response on a rotating basis, including evenings and weekends;
  • Works collaboratively with the Clinical Team;
  • Driving and travel throughout the County required
